怎样在VSCode中设置断点进行调试?

首先配置launch.json文件并设置断点,然后启动调试。在VSCode中,通过点击行号旁空白或右键选择“切换断点”来设置断点,按F5启动调试,程序遇断点暂停后可查看变量和调用堆,支持条件断点与日志断点,确保代码被执行且路径正确以避免断点未命中。

怎样在vscode中设置断点进行调试?

在 VSCode 中设置断点进行调试非常直接,只需要几个步骤就能开始排查代码问题。关键是配置好调试环境,并正确启用断点。

设置断点的方法

在编辑器中打开你要调试的代码文件,然后进行以下操作:

点击代码行号左侧的空白区域,会出现一个红点,表示断点已设置 也可以通过右键点击行号,选择“切换断点”来添加或删除 按住 CtrlmacOS 上是 Cmd)并点击多个位置可设置多个断点

配置调试环境(launch.json)

VSCode 使用 launch.json 文件来定义调试配置。首次调试时需要生成该文件:

面试猫 面试猫

AI面试助手,在线面试神器,助你轻松拿Offer

面试猫 39 查看详情 面试猫 打开“运行和调试”侧边栏(快捷键 Ctrl+Shift+D) 点击“创建 launch.json 文件”,根据提示选择运行环境(如 Node.js、Python、PHP 等) 编辑生成的配置,确保 program 指向你的入口文件(例如 app.js 或 main.py)

启动调试会话

完成断点和配置后,就可以开始调试:

确保当前选中的调试配置正确 点击“启动调试”按钮(绿色三角)或按 F5 程序会在遇到断点时暂停,此时可在“变量”“调用堆栈”等面板查看运行状态 使用顶部的控制按钮:继续、单步跳过、单步进入、单步跳出

条件断点与日志断点

除了普通断点,还可以设置更高级的断点类型:

条件断点:右键已设断点,选择“编辑断点”,输入条件表达式,仅当条件为真时中断 日志断点:输入要输出的信息,如 ‘当前值: {variable}’,不会中断执行,只在调试控制台打印基本上就这些。只要调试器能正常启动,断点就会生效。注意检查代码是否正在被实际执行,有时断点显示为空心说明未命中,可能是路径或执行流程问题。

以上就是怎样在VSCode中设置断点进行调试?的详细内容,更多请关注php中文网其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/438992.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
荣耀20青春版驱动程序在哪(荣耀20青春版驱动安装教程)
上一篇 2025年11月7日 17:47:48
MySQL如何检查约束_MySQL约束查看与完整性检查教程
下一篇 2025年11月7日 17:47:54

相关推荐

发表回复

登录后才能评论
关注微信